About the book
About Stitches & Snake Oil
Prudence, the town seamstress, lives a quiet life defined by routine: early mornings with her young son, Bryant, and her shop door opening late at the ninth bell. An emigrant from the conservative community of Holderdown, she is cautious of North Pointe Common Towne's vibrant magic and keeps her own gifts tightly restrained, crafting only the most plain and utilitarian garments. But when a charismatic "snake oil" salesman arrives, hawking fraudulent "destiny potions" from his wagon just inside the road gates, Prudence's carefully constructed world threatens to unravel. The salesman is a ghost from her past, a figure of unwanted marriage who embodies the judgmental conservatism she sought to escape. As the town's communal magic seems to thin around her, Prudence is consumed by a fear that this fraud is destined to fill an open spot in the sacred Icosagon, poisoning the heart of their home. To defend her community and her new life, Prudence must finally confront her own internalized fears and unleash the extraordinary power of her craft: the ability to make clothes that don't just fit the person, but fit their destiny. Stitches & Snake Oil is a heartfelt story about choosing self-acceptance over self-restriction, proving that the brightest path forward is paved not with plain duty, but with courageous expression.
